News Clarification – ‘ITC looks to add spice maker Sunrise Foods to its menu’
Reference is made to your letter no. NSE/CM/Surveillance/9196 dated 1[st] April, 2020 with respect to a news item which appeared on ‘www.moneycontrol.com’ captioned “ITC looks to add spice maker Sunrise Foods to its menu”.
We write to advise that the Company, as part of its business strategy, is always exploring inorganic growth opportunities and enquiries received from the market participants are suitably evaluated. With respect to the captioned news item, we would like to inform that the Company has not entered into any exclusivity agreement for acquisition of Sunrise Foods Private Limited.
While on the subject, we draw your attention that if and when there is any material development with respect to the affairs of the Company, the Stock Exchanges are kept advised, pursuant to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015 read with the Company’s Policy for determination of materiality of events and information for disclosure to the Stock Exchanges.
